Output 8a689b59f25f73212d52a215693e3925277db27241edf42206d4302e488e5e6a:0

value
637800000
script pubkey
OP_0 OP_PUSHBYTES_20 d23f50db72d35cf8bf607f39143ab24ccc84f26e
address
ltc1q6gl4pkmj6dw030mq0uu3gw4jfnxgfunwy9cduf
transaction
8a689b59f25f73212d52a215693e3925277db27241edf42206d4302e488e5e6a
spent
true